A first grade teacher collected well known proverbs.
 
She gave each child in her class the first half of a proverb and
asked them to come up with the remainder of the proverb.  Their
insight may surprise you.

 

Better to be safe than.....................Punch a 5th grader
 

Strike while the ..........................Bug is close
 

It's always darkest before.................Daylight Savings Time
 

Never underestimate the power of...........Termites
 

You can lead a horse to water but..........how?
 

Don't bite the hand that...................looks dirty
 

No news is.................................impossible
 

A miss is as good as a.....................Mr...
 

You can't teach an old dog new.............math
 

If you lie down with dogs, you'll..........stink in the morning
 

Love all, trust............................me
 

The pen is mightier than the...............pigs
 

An idle mind is............................The best way to relax
 

Where there's smoke there's................pollution
 

Happy the bride who........................gets all the presents
 

A penny saved is...........................not much
 

Two's company, three's.....................the Musketeers
 

Don't put off till tomorrow what...........you put on to go to bed
 

Laugh and the whole world laughs with you, cry and....you have to
blow your nose

 

None are so blind as.......................Stevie Wonder
 

Children should be seen and not............spanked or grounded
 

If at first you don't succeed..............get new batteries
 

You get out of something what you..........see pictured on the box
 

When the blind leadeth the blind...........get out of the way
 

Better late than...........................pregnant.
